Police investigating shooting in central Las Vegas

A person was shot in the chest Thursday night in the central Las Vegas Valley, police said.

Metro officers responded on reports of the shooting about 8:20 p.m. to the 2800 block of North Pecos Road, near Las Vegas Boulevard North, Metropolitan Police Department Lt. Peter Kisfalvi said.

The person shot was hospitalized, and his injuries appeared survivable, Kisfalvi said.

He said the shooting may have been gang-related.

No further information was immediately available.
